你查询的IP:[121.58.63.106]  地理位置:中国–海南–三亚

最新查询119.2.229.187 221.12.103.25 120.64.16.221 210.5.144.146 124.240.80.151 124.254.9.203 60.235.29.153 117.40.41.157 222.176.187.2 121.58.63.106 202.131.48.31 116.116.166.8 116.116.50.90 117.21.223.80 121.48.117.206 121.8.126.139 124.112.28.242 122.156.168.207 203.176.168.17 120.137.246.171 124.72.134.10 210.192.96.184 124.243.192.203 60.194.85.207 120.52.132.52 125.254.128.115 124.192.237.56 211.160.181.210 220.231.54.33 58.128.23.214 125.58.128.77